COMMUNITY NEWS Paris Museum reopens after brief closure By Casandra Turnbull The Paris Museum and Historical Society has officially opened the doors to 2024. After a brief closure to reorganize, catalogue and prepare for the year ahead, Museum staff announced on February 14th that they were open and ready for visitors. In a Social Media post announcing the reopening, staff revealed “We got some things done while we were closed. Others are still in progress. We organized things behind the scenes that you will never notice, like filing papers, organizing the art shelves, tracking down items without object numbers on them, and reassigning locations. We also did some things you are more likely to notice, like moving the cobblestone houses into the foyer, moving the diorama, and moving the Paris industries into a case.” All this shifting and rearranging will leave some open space for guest speakers, workshops and meetings. The timing is impeccable as the Museum prepares to welcome speaker Abel Land on February 25, who will discuss Napoleonic Military in Pop Culture. Abel is the assistant Curator at the Fashion History Museum in Cambridge. Join Abel at 2 pm as they discuss how pop culture has interpreted the Napoleonic British Military, and how it is so far from the actual truth! Admission is by donation only. Donations help the Museum preserve Paris’ rich history. If you haven’t visited the Museum before or are new to town and would like to learn more about this quaint community (maybe your fascination is fulled by the Paris Independent’s Chris Whelan who brings his Paris Past column to life each week?) drop by the facility located at 51 William Street – aka – the old Syl Apps Arena.
